MasOrange streamlines telecom customer service with AI-powered chatbot

MasOrange, a major Spanish telecommunications operator, faced mounting customer service challenges due to high call volumes and lengthy invoice-related queries. In response, PwC Spain and MasOrange developed a sophisticated AI-powered conversational agent using Microsoft Azure OpenAI services, deployed via WhatsApp. The solution automated invoice explanations leveraging Azure AI Search for Retrieval-Augmented Generation and Form Recognizer for invoice parsing, greatly reducing manual intervention. The chatbot continuously learned from interactions, optimizing responses while integrating seamlessly with existing customer service workflows. This innovative project was executed in multiple phases: knowledge base creation, invoice data extraction, prompt engineering, and iterative optimization. By improving response speed and accuracy, MasOrange could alleviate pressure on call centers, focus staff on complex issues, and enhance customer loyalty through a superior service experience.

Architecture

Customer queries on WhatsApp trigger the Azure OpenAI chatbot. The bot retrieves invoice-related information via Azure AI Search, uses Azure Form Recognizer to extract invoice data, generates explanations using Retrieval-Augmented Generation, and adapts over time through iterative learning.
